Subject: Key rotation for InvoiceForge renderer

Welcome, new folks. Every quarter we rotate the credential the Pellworth PDF invoice renderer uses to call our internal asset service, Vaultline. The old key stops working Friday at noon. Update your local .env and the staging config before then, and verify a test invoice renders with the new embedded fonts. For convenience, the freshly issued key is included here.

app token of bagef-bageg = kto11_vuwA0uhrEMg

Subject: Cut-over to Brindle handlers — summary

Team, the cut-over to the serverless Brindle handlers finished last night with no dropped requests. One thing new folks should know: cold starts on the report-export handler run 3–4 seconds, so we keep a warmer pinging it every few minutes. Latency graphs will look spiky until caches fill. Old VMs stay up read-only for two weeks as a fallback. The handlers were deployed with the following configuration.

service settings:
[casax]
port = 6379
team = rusir
host = casax.zemvarhq.corp
region = outer-4
access_code = ac_9808ce
timeout_ms = 1500

Handover note — Crumbwheel order cutoffs.

Welcome aboard. The bakery cutoff rule in Crumbwheel closes same-day orders at 14:00 local to each storefront, not UTC — this has bitten us twice. Holiday overrides live in the calendar service and take precedence silently, so always check there first when a cutoff looks wrong. To unlock the calendar service's admin console after a restart, enter the recovery passphrase below.

vault phrase of bagap-bahaf = silion-pelox-sorox-casdor-quenwyn-fraax-eliox-praael-kelion-quenvan-kasox-rusael-norius-belvan

Heads up for the release cut: the ProctorFlow exam-proctoring queue stopped pulling sessions overnight because the worker credentials expired on schedule. Students weren't affected yet, but the backlog is growing. I've rotated the key in Vaultlet and the new one is active now. Please swap it into the release config before tagging. Here's the fresh key for the queue service:

service key, fawip-bajef: kto11_Qt5wZK9vdNC